* macvtap ml2 driver and agent - will land in neutron tree. Question is how to procede with agent code (scheuran)
 
** '''Aug 17 2015 update''' - sc68cal is working with scheuran in this gerrit topic https://review.openstack.org/#/q/status:open+project:openstack/neutron+branch:master+topic:bug/1468803,n,z
 
** 1) Copy (duplicate) required agent code like in the past.
 
** 2) Extract a common base class for macvtap, linuxbridge and sriov-nic (impls are close to each other). Purpose: Sharing base agent code. Starting with macvtap only in liberty. Moving others to common base class in Mitaka. New agent base class cannot be used for OVS, as it already diverged too much from others.
 
*** Liberty: only methods that are obious common and only differ in details that can be abstracted (_setup_rpc, _report_state, _device_info_has_changes, _process_network_devices)
 
*** Mitaka: Methods that have a lot of common code, but require fruther thinking (treat_devices_added_updated, scan_devices, daemon_loop)
 
*** N: Having a common agent with interface drivers?
 
** Modular l2 agent (spec not in a good shape) and agent extension (is just for extending existing agents) is is not an option
